According to a Bloomberg report, the shares of the following companies may see some unusual trading moves today.

After the close of Friday’s trading, Berkshire Hathaway, Inc. (NYSE: BRK.B), the insurance and investment company owned by Warren Buffet, became part of the S&P 500 index.

Blackstone Group LP (NYSE: BX) gained 5.3% to reach $13.50 as ownership pattern of Merlin Entertainments Group Ltd, 48% owned by Blackstone changed.

Blue Nile,Inc. (NYSE: NILE) may suffer losses on its shares due to fall in the number of visitors on its website, and subsequent decline of its earnings.

As per Securities and Exchange Commission, Carl Icahn, and Ralph Whitworth, money managers who run activist funds raised their stake in Genzyme Corp. (NYSE: GENZ), a biotechnology company, in the fourth quarter of 2009.

JP Morgan Chase & Co. (NYSE: JPM), second largest bank in the US, gained 0.3% to reach $39.07 as it agreed to take over RBS Sempra Commodities LLP’s non-US assets for $1.7bn.

Merck & Co. (NYSE: MRK), the second largest pharmaceutical company in the US, reported profit of 79 cents per share for its fourth quarter of 2009, beating the average Bloomberg analysts’ estimate of 78 cents per share. Addition of Schering-Plough products to its product line helped it achieve revenue growth of 67% to $10.1bn.

NII Holdings (NYSE: NIHD), provider of digital wireless communication services, gained 8.1 % to reach $39 as its recommendation was raised to “buy” from “neutral” by Bank of America Corp. (NYSE: BAC) backed by the news that Grupo Televisa SA (ADR) (NYSE: TV) is to buy a 30% stake in NII’s Mexico unit in all cash deal of $1.44bn.

Software developer, Oracle Corporation (NYSE: ORCL) may reach up to $32 in the next 12 months on the back of revenue boost from the recently purchased Sun Microsystems, Inc.

Oshkosh Corp (NYSE: OSK), a commercial, and military truck maker gained 7.6% to reach $41.25, as it beat BAE Systems Plc (ADR) (OTC: BAESY), and Navistar International Corp. (NYSE: NAV) to retain a US Army contract worth $3bn.

Rigel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NYSE: RIGL) gained 6.7% to reach $10.06 as its rights for experimental arthritis treatment were bought by AstraZeneca (ADR) (NYSE: AZN) for $1.25bn. Shares of Terra Industries, Inc. (NYSE: TRA) soared 22% to $40.08 as the company announced that it will be acquired by Yara International ASA (ADR) (OTC: YARIY) for $41.10 for each share amounting to a total of $4.1bn.

Carl Icahn, a billionaire hedge fund manager, sold 38 million out of his 50 million shares of Yahoo! Inc. (NYSE: YHOO).
